County declares state of emergency

The Jeff Davis County Commission last week declared a state of emergency in Jeff Davis County as a result of the Jan. 30 fire at the facility that housed the Jeff Davis County E-911 Center, Emergency Medical Service and Emergency Management Agency (EMA).
